In order to not get problems with DNS cache pruning, we no longer store
any name resolved data in any curl handle struct. That way, we won't mind if the cache entries are pruned for the next time we need them. We'll just resolve them again instead. This changes the Curl_resolv() proto. It modifies the SessionHandle struct but perhaps most importantly, it'll make the internals somewhat dependent on the DNS cache not being disabled as that will cripple operations somewhat. Especially for persistant connections.
